Flux rss
Collection CommentCaMarche.net
Rechercher : dans
Par : Pertinence Date Nom d'utilisateur
Statut : Non résolu

Cacher une url en php

parisien4ever, le jeudi 6 janvier 2005 à 13:38:50
voila
J'ai créé un scipt php d'authentification
Selon les identifiants rentrés, l'utilisateur accès a différentes pages cependant l'adresse de ces pages est visible et je voudrais la cacher ou la modifié dans la fenetre de l'utilisateur afin qu'il n'ai pas seulement a taper l'adresse pour accéder a la page
J'utilise header() pour la redirection quelqu'un a t il une idée ?
Répondre à parisien4ever  Signaler ce message aux modérateurs Aller au dernier message

1


  • Ce message vous semble utile, votez !
  • Signaler ce message aux modérateurs
sebsauvage, le jeudi 6 janvier 2005 à 14:31:48
Mauvaise idée.

Il faut, dans chaque page qui doit être protégée, vérifier que le user a bien droit d'accéder à cette page.
C'est la seule façon fiable de procéder.

Simplement masquer l'URL ne protègera pas les pages, et si un de tes utilisateur diffuse les URL, tout le monde pourra y accéder.
C'est bien trop dangereux.
Répondre à sebsauvage

2


  • Ce message vous semble utile, votez !
  • Signaler ce message aux modérateurs
 Willy, le jeudi 6 janvier 2005 à 17:13:10
Je connais pas une telle instruction en PHP mais c'st sure ken incluant un bout de javascript ds ton code, tu peut cacher la barre d'adresse.

Mais, comme t'a dit l'autre, cela ne protège en rien ton progrmme. Utilise dc la solution kil te propose en protégeant toutes les pages.

En fait il n'y a k1e seule page ke tu protèges et tu fais apparaitre les autres page ds celles ci.

Le truc: tu as une page "index.php" ki comporte un tableau dt les celles st tes pages visitées. Chake fois kon clik sur un lien, cela provoke un rechargement de la même page index. Index alors avt de se charger exécute un script de connexion. Mais comme tu peux utiliser des noms de variable avec php, tu fera ds le tableau de "index.php" des 'include($nom_page)'. '$nom_page' sera transmis ds ton URL

En aliant les méthodes, tu peut avoir un site securisé.

Escuses moi si c'est confus mais Je te send un exemple dès ke possible.

bonne chance
Répondre à Willy

Résultats pour cacher une url en php

Passage de variable par URL PHP 4.3.10 (Résolu) Bonjour les amis. Je voudrais faire de passages de variables par URL en php(). Tt se passait bien jusqu'a ce que je me decide à utiliser Easyphp 1.8(Apache 1.3.33, Mysql 4.1.9, PHP4.3.10). page.php ne reçoit pas la variable... www.commentcamarche.net/forum/affich-1403381-passage-de-variable-par-url-php-4-3-10
Passage de paramètre par URL [php] (Résolu) re-Bonjour, Cette fois ci je bloque sur le passage de variable par URL. Voici ma structure, j'ai un tableau (une liste) qui se charge d'url $query = "SELECT DISTINCT type,marque FROM vehicule WHERE type='voiture' ORDER BY nom"; ..... www.commentcamarche.net/forum/affich-7736367-passage-de-parametre-par-url-php

Résultats pour cacher une url en php

Il est possible de récupérer le code source PHP d'un siteMythe Un utilisateur peut récupérer le code source PHP d'un site web comme il peut récupérer le code HTML. Réalité FAUX Explications Les fichiers PHP (ASP, JSP, etc.) sont des fichiers interprétés côté serveur, ce qui signifie que le serveur web... www.commentcamarche.net/faq/sujet-5613-il-est-possible-de-recuperer-le-code-source-php-d-un-site
Sécuriser son code PHPIndépendamment de la sécurisation du système d'exploitation du serveur, du serveur HTTP lui-même et des options de configuration de PHP (php.ini), il est important de veiller à sécuriser les données provenant des utilisateurs (via les formulaires ou... www.commentcamarche.net/faq/sujet-10462-securiser-son-code-php
[PHP] Transformer une URL en lien hypertexte cliquableGrâce aux expressions régulières, il est possible de transformer en lien hypertexte toute URL de la forme http://URL (ou ftp://URL) ou bien commençant par www. : www.commentcamarche.net/faq/sujet-891-php-transformer-une-url-en-lien-hypertexte-cliquable

Résultats pour cacher une url en php

Syntaxe url php + Mysql (Résolu)Salut ! Pouvez-vous m'aider à résoudre un petit soucis que j'ai, s'il vous plaît ? voila : Je récupère une url dans une base de données et j'essaie de l'afficher avec ce code : $query = "SELECT urlimage FROM produits WHERE... www.commentcamarche.net/forum/affich-6598099-syntaxe-url-php-mysql
Comment récupérer l'url d'une page php ? (Résolu)Bonjour, je cherche comment récupérer l'url de la page web, dans laquelle une personne se trouve. Quelle fonction existe-t-il en php ? Merci d'avance pour votre aide. www.commentcamarche.net/forum/affich-1557182-comment-recuperer-l-url-d-une-page-php
[PHP]recupération url avec variable (Résolu)Bonjour, Je souhaiterai recupérer une url avec toutes ses variables derriere, je m'explique: j'ai une url du type page.php?param1=val1¶m2=val2¶m3=val3............................ etc dans cette page j'ai un lien qui rajoute une... www.commentcamarche.net/forum/affich-5173365-php-recuperation-url-avec-variable

Résultats pour cacher une url en php

Télécharger Index.dat AnalyzerIndex.dat Analyzer permet de voir, éditer et effacer le contenu de ces fichiers - théoriquement cachés - qui participent aux fonctions de cache d'Internet explorer, et stockent un certain nombre de vos traces sur internet (urls notamment), mais aussi... www.commentcamarche.net/telecharger/telecharger-34055298-index-dat-analyzer

Résultats pour cacher une url en php

PHP - Bases de donnéesPhp permet un interfaçage très simple avec un grand nombre de bases de données. Lorsqu'une base de données n'est pas directement supportée par Php, il est possible d'utiliser un driver ODBC, pilote standard pour communiquer avec les bases de... www.commentcamarche.net/contents/php/phpbdd.php3
PHP - Expressions régulièresQu'est-ce qu'une expression régulière? Les expressions régulières sont des modèles créés à l'aide de caractères ASCII permettant de manipuler des chaînes de caractères, c'est-à-dire permettant de trouver les portions de la chaîne correspondant au... www.commentcamarche.net/contents/php/phpreg.php3